- 50 years of service - from dispatcher to Lancaster County's longest serving sheriff. Join us as Sheriff Terry Wagner reflects on his 50-year journey in law enforcement, sharing stories, challenges, and lessons learned along the way. Discover how leadership, technology, and community service have evolved over five decades.

- Sheriff Wagner provides a recap of his 2026 State of the Office Address. Each year, Sheriff Wagner addresses LSO staff to look back on the past year and discuss what lies ahead. In light of his announced retirement, this will be the Sheriff's final year in office and his final State of the Office address. This 902 Podcast episode brings that address directly to the public, with the Sheriff reflecting on 2025 and what's in store for the final year of his last term.

In this episode, Captain John Vik interviews Sarah Draper, a former West Point graduate, military police officer, and supervisory FBI agent, who now focuses on helping others lead well. They discuss Sarah's journey from military service to the FBI, her transition into wellness coaching, and the importance of gratitude in enhancing mental health and resilience. Sarah shares practical tools for cultivating gratitude and emphasizes its benefits for individuals and communities, particularly in high-stress professions like law enforcement.

The 902 Podcast is the official podcast of the Lancaster County Sheriff's Office in Lincoln, Nebraska. On each episode, Sheriff Wagner will be joined by command staff and other special guests to take listeners inside LSO to discuss topics like recruiting, public safety technology, and operations to keep Lancaster County safe. Join us for behind-the-scenes access to all that's happening at LSO. This podcast is produced by the Lancaster County Sheriff's Office.
